Dreamfall: The Longest Journey vs FINAL FANTASY X/X-2 HD Remaster
Dreamfall: The Longest Journey is a puzzle RPG game from Funcom (2006) while FINAL FANTASY X/X-2 HD Remaster is a JRPG open-world game from Square Enix (2016).
What each one is
Steam files Dreamfall: The Longest Journey under Puzzle and RPG. In contrast, it files FINAL FANTASY X/X-2 HD Remaster under JRPG and Open-World.
Dreamfall: The Longest Journey, winner of multiple E3 awards as the best game in its genre, is the continuation of a saga that began in the award-winning The Longest Journey, considered to be one of the finest adventure games ever made.
FINAL FANTASY X/X-2 HD Remaster celebrates two of the most cherished and beloved entries to the world-renowned franchise, completely remastered in gorgeous High Definition & now available on PC / Windows!

Players. The share of Steam reviews marked positive, pulled toward the catalogue average in proportion to how few reviews stand behind it. A game with 200 reviews moves a long way toward the average; one with 200,000 barely moves at all. Without this a title sitting at 100 percent on nine reviews outranks Half-Life 2 at 98 percent on 278,000.
Popularity. A blend of two things that are not the same. Audience is how many people wrote a Steam review, which is a floor on how many played it. Reach is how many language editions of Wikipedia document the game, which is cultural footprint rather than sales. A game can score high on one and low on the other: a huge free-to-play title has audience without reach, and a landmark console exclusive has reach without a Steam audience at all. Where both exist they are averaged; where only one does, that one carries it.
